1. The Primary Distinction: Hobtop vs. Cooktop

The most significant choice you’ll make is between a Hobtop and a standard Cooktop:

FeatureFaber Hobtop (Prime Series)Faber Cooktop (Daisy, Jumbo Series)
InstallationHybrid. Can be used as a countertop unit or permanently built into a pre-cut kitchen slab for a sleek, flush finish.Standalone Tabletop. Designed to sit directly on the kitchen counter, offering portability.
DesignTypically more premium, featuring an 8mm Toughened Glass surface and premium metal knobs.Standard design, focused on robustness and functionality.
Cut-OutRequires a precise cut-out (e.g., $555 \text{ mm} \times 475 \text{ mm}$ for HT703).No cut-out required.

Verdict: Choose a Hobtop if you have a modular kitchen and desire a seamless, high-end look. Choose a standard Cooktop if you need portability, are budget-conscious, or prefer a simple countertop placement.

2. Performance & Precision: The Burner Technology

Faber distinguishes its models based on burner efficiency and control.

Burner TypePerformance CharacteristicsModels
Multi-Flame BurnerFeatures two or more concentric flame rings controlled by a single knob. This provides superior heat control, allowing for everything from a high-power triple ring for fast heating to a low single ring for perfect simmering. Highly efficient.Hobtop Prime HT703, HT704
Standard Brass BurnerDurable, fuel-efficient brass burners, commonly used in most Indian gas stoves. Reliable and long-lasting.Daisy 3BB, Jumbo 4BB BK AI, Crystal 3BB SS
Jumbo BurnerAn oversized brass burner specifically designed for large Indian utensils like kadhais and pressure cookers. It ensures even heat distribution across the wide base of large vessels.Hobtop Prime HT703, Cooktop Jumbo 4BB AI

Verdict: For unmatched cooking precision and flexibility, the Multi-Flame burners in the Hobtop Prime series are the superior choice.

3. Key Feature Deep Dive (Buyer’s Checklist)

A. Pan Support Material

The material of the pan support (trivet) affects stability and durability.

  • Cast Iron (CI): Found on the Hobtop Prime models. CI is heavier, provides greater stability for large vessels, and retains heat better. It’s the standard for premium hobs.
  • Aluminium Trivet: Used on the Cooktop Jumbo. It is lighter and easier to clean.
  • Black Diamond Coated: Used on the Cooktop Daisy. Designed to be scratch-resistant and durable.

B. Ignition Type

  • Auto Ignition (AI): Featured on the Hobtop Prime, Jumbo, and Crystal models. It ignites the flame automatically with a simple turn and push of the knob, eliminating the need for a lighter or matchstick.
  • Manual Ignition (MI): Featured on the Cooktop Daisy. Requires an external source (lighter or matchstick) to light the burner.

C. Surface Material

  • Toughened Black Glass: Found on almost all top-selling models (Prime, Daisy, Jumbo). It offers a modern, sleek aesthetic and is easy to wipe clean. Faber provides an excellent 5-year warranty on the glass.
  • Stainless Steel (SS): Featured on the Cooktop Crystal 3BB SS. It is extremely durable, resists chipping, and is a practical choice for heavy use, though it requires more effort to keep smudge-free.

II. Performance & Technology

Q4: What is the benefit of the Multi-Flame Burner (found in Hobtop Prime) over a standard Tri-Pin burner?

A: The Multi-Flame Burner provides greater cooking versatility and control.5 It features multiple concentric flame rings that are controlled by a single knob, allowing you to:

  • Achieve a high-intensity, large flame (Triple-Ring) for fast heating and deep frying.
  • Use a very low, single-ring flame for controlled simmering and slow cooking.This precision is ideal for varied Indian and international cuisine.

Q5: What is the purpose of the ‘Jumbo Burner’ and which models include it?

A: The Jumbo Burner is an oversized, high-output burner designed for using large Indian utensils (like heavy-duty pressure cookers or large kadhais).6 It ensures the flame covers the entire base of the utensil, leading to faster and more uniform cooking. It is a key feature in models like the Hobtop Prime HT703 and the Cooktop Jumbo 4BB AI.

Q6: Are Faber cooktops suitable for both LPG (Cylinder Gas) and PNG (Piped Natural Gas)?

A: Yes, but they are typically factory-set for LPG. If you use PNG, you must arrange for a nozzle conversion by an authorized technician or your PNG provider. This is necessary because PNG operates at a lower pressure than LPG.
